New veg of the week- Beetroot

This week I added beetroot into his weekly purees.
Benefits of beetroot for babies - Rich in minerals & vitamins, decrease risk of anemia, protects liver and increased brain activity.
Beetroot contains high amount of nitrates, therefore it is more advisable to give in small amount, steam or boil properly and to mix with other vegetables, especially if child is younger than a year old.
During baby Reagan's teething stage now, he preferred his purees to have more texture, so instead of pureeing till it's smooth and creamy, I mashed them with a fork instead.
Preparing the beetroots can be quite messy as they stained my hands and entire kitchen counter with its purple dye. Well, still I hope baby boy likes this new vegetable introduced to him this week.
